Speaking as I would to engineering students, engineers always try to look at evidence before issuing a conclusion. Lots of crappy design and construction ideas were tried 30-50 years ago and we will probably start seeing failures, some quite spectacular, as unanticipated deterioration causes critical parts to be stressed to failure. This failure may have been sabotage but it could also be a structural failure. To keep credibility one waits for an investigation before announcing conclusions. We have very few images of buildings collapsing naturally. It's hard to say what is normal and what is not. I suspect some of the flashes are electrical arcs as lines to rooftop AC units are broken then grounded out. Others may be televisions or other light sources visible from outside as curtains move and screens drop. Cars in the basement will have ruptured fuel tanks igniting. Nothing conclusive here yet.
